Jupiter Theme Custom Icons Not Working in Header

by nickdevyyc   Last Updated July 17, 2018 16:08 PM

The Jupiter social media icons don't natively allow you to add custom icons. But I found this tutorial: http://forums.artbees.net/t/adding-custom-icons-at-various-places-to-the-jupiter-theme/12724

Here are the following changes that I made - which followed the tutorial exactly.

1. jupiter/framework/admin/control-panel/v2/panes/icon-library.php

Added the following to lines 60-61

<span class="mka-select-list-item" data-value="themeicons">
    <?php esc_html_e( 'Theme Icons', 'mk_framework' ); ?>

2. jupiter/assets/icons/theme-icons/map.json

Added the following code to the end of the file


3. jupiter/assets/icons/theme-icons/svg

I created the file e69c.svg

Added the following svg code to e69c.svg...

<?xml version="1.0" encoding="utf-8"?><!-- Generator: Adobe Illustrator 16.0.0, SVG Export Plug-In . SVG Version: 6.00 Build 0)  --><!DOCTYPE svg PUBLIC "-//W3C//DTD SVG 1.1//EN" "http://www.w3.org/Graphics/SVG/1.1/DTD/svg11.dtd"><svg version="1.1" id="Layer_1" xmlns="http://www.w3.org/2000/svg" xmlns:xlink="http://www.w3.org/1999/xlink" x="0px" y="0px" width="16px" height="16px" viewBox="632 392 16 16" enable-background="new 632 392 16 16" xml:space="preserve"> <g> <path d="M639.998,392.016c-4.417,0-7.998,3.577-7.998,7.99c0,4.412,3.581,7.989,7.998,7.989c4.416,0,7.997-3.577,7.997-7.989 C647.995,395.592,644.414,392.016,639.998,392.016z M643.9,404.373h-2.885v-2.961h-2.086v2.961h-2.834v-8.737h2.021v2.107 l5.783,1.647V404.373z"/></g></svg>

4. jupiter/framework/admin/control-panel/logic/icons-list.php

Added the following code at the end of the file.

1909 => array(
    'n' => 'mk-jupiter-icon-custom',
    'l' => 'themeicons',

5. jupiter/framework/admin/theme-options/masterkey.php

Added the following code underneath google-plus

'houzz' => array( 'Houzz', 'mk-jupiter-icon-custom' ),

Now in the screenshot in the tutorial - Houzz is now showing up.

houzz icon in jupiter theme header icons

But on the website, it doesn't show up. FYI the Houzz icon showing up is the Wordpress one jus swapped out. It should appear beside it.

houzz icon in jupiter theme header icons on website

Any help would be appreciated!

Related Questions

Multiple Blog Layouts, one WordPress install?

Updated May 14, 2017 13:08 PM

Can you guys suggest similar kind of WP theme

Updated April 03, 2018 11:08 AM

Wordpress Theme Development

Updated September 27, 2017 07:08 AM

Alignment Problem

Updated February 20, 2018 23:08 PM

Add a dropdown to theme customizer

Updated June 14, 2017 09:08 AM